Teachers Eligibility Test (TET) – 2019

Teachers Eligibility Test is a necessary certificate from government to become teacher in India. The Teachers Eligibility Test is conducted in two papers –PAPER 1 for Primary Level – (1st to 5th Classes) and PAPER 2 for Upper Primary Level – (6th to 10th Classes). Even some states conduct PAPER 3 for the secondary level recruitments.

Validity of TET/CTET Exam Certificate

S. NO. Name of TET Exam Validity Year
1. CTET 7 year
2. TET 5 year

Educational Qualification for TET/CTET Exam 2019

Candidates applying for CTET/TET exam 2019 must go through the listed educational qualification to be eligible to sit in the exams.

PAPER – 1 (Primary Level – 1st to 5th)
Applicants must have passed the Senior Secondary class with at least 50% marks and a 2 Year Diploma in Elementary Education
OR
Applicants must have passed the senior secondary class with at least 50% marks and a 4 Years Bachelor of Elementary Education
OR
Applicants must have a Bachelor Degree with a 2 Year Diploma in Elementary Education
PAPER – 2 ( Upper Primary Level – 6th to 10th)
Candidates completed Bachelor Degree and passed or appearing in the final year of 2 year diploma in Elementary Education
OR
Candidates completed Bachelor Degree with at least 50% and passed or appearing in the 1st year of B.Ed.
OR
Candidates passed Senior Secondary (+2 class) with at least 50% marks and passed or appearing in the final year of B.Ed.

TET/CTET Exam Pattern and Syllabus 2019

Candidates appearing for the TET exam must have information about the exam pattern to get selected in exam. The written examination will consists of Multiple Choice Questions i.e. MCQs which will carry equal marks in the test. No negative marking is there in any paper.

TET/CTET Exam Pattern & Syllabus for PAPER – 1

S. NO. Subject Number of Question Marks Exam Duration
1. Child Development & Pedagogy 30 30 150 Minutes
2. Mathematics 30 30 150 Minutes
3. Language – 1 30 30 150 Minutes
4. Language – 2 30 30 150 Minutes
5. Environmental Studies 30 30 150 Minutes
Total 150 150

TET/CTET Exam Pattern & Syllabus for PAPER – 2

S. NO. Subject Number of Question Marks Exam Duration
1. Child Development & Pedagogy 30 30 150 Minutes
2. Language – 1 30 30 150 Minutes
3. Language – 2 30 30 150 Minutes
4. Science & Mathematics or Social Science 60 60 150 Minutes
Total 150 150

TET/CTET Qualifying Marks for Different Categories

Exams Category Percentage of Qualifying Marks Passing Marks Total Marks
General 60% 90 150
ST/SC/OBC 55% 82 150
